Frostwire was created when, when under pressure from the RIAA, Limewire considered placing drm code into their software. Frostwire promises to be free, from both cost and malware. Both Limewire and Frostwire use the gnutella network and can be used as a bittorent client. #5: FrostWire. A torrent client you never knew you needed. The term leech also refers to a peer (or peers) that has a negative effect on the swarm by having a very poor share ratio, downloading much more than they upload.
